Early Life and Career Beginnings

Wayne Brady began his journey towards success in the entertainment industry by honing his talents in community theatre in Florida before making his debut in the drama ‘A Raisin in the Sun.’

Transitioning to Los Angeles in 1996, Brady quickly gained recognition for his hosting role on VH-1’s Vinyl Justice and his appearances on the hit show Whose Line Is It Anyway? His versatility and charm led him to produce, write, and star in The Wayne Brady Show in 2001.

Despite the show’s eventual cancellation, Brady’s career continued to flourish with numerous TV appearances and hosting opportunities. His ability to connect with audiences through humor and relatability solidified his presence in the entertainment industry.

Rise to Fame on Television

Rising to fame on television, Wayne Brady showcased his comedic talent and improvisational skills through his role on the popular improv comedy show Whose Line Is It Anyway? starting in 1997. Over his tenure on the show, appearing in more than 200 episodes, Brady captivated audiences with his quick wit and humor. His success on Whose Line Is It Anyway? paved the way for his own variety show, The Wayne Brady Show, which aired from 2001 to 2004, further establishing his presence in the television industry.

Brady’s charisma and hosting abilities led to him taking on the role of host and executive producer of the game show Let’s Make a Deal in 2009, a position he still holds. His seamless transition from improv comedy to hosting demonstrated his versatility in the entertainment industry. Financial Success Through Various Ventures

After captivating audiences with his comedic talent on Whose Line Is It Anyway? and establishing his presence in the television industry, Wayne Brady’s financial success through various ventures has solidified his position as a prominent figure in the entertainment world.

With an estimated net worth of $12 million as of 2023, Brady has leveraged his acting jobs and real estate investments to build his wealth significantly. Notably, he made lucrative real estate deals, such as selling his Sherman Oaks house for $2.65 million in 2018, as well as another property in the same area for $1.8 million. Brady’s financial acumen is further evidenced by the sale of a 3-bedroom condo for $1.8 million, showcasing his adeptness in diverse investment opportunities.
